## Authentication

Picklane's optimizer calls the internal Slotgrid service for bin coordinates. No user-level auth; everything is service-to-service. Requests are signed per-call, retries capped at three. Staging and prod use separate credentials — never share. The optimizer loads its Slotgrid credential from config at boot, specifically the key below.

service key, fawip-bajef: kto11_Qt5wZK9vdNC

**Ticket WK-914: Viewer role can edit restricted wiki pages**

Heads up for the security review — on Quillpad, users with the plain Viewer role can edit pages under the `/restricted` tree if they arrive via the search result link instead of normal navigation. Looks like the permission check only fires on the nav path. Not exploitable for admin pages (those have a second gate), but still bad. Repro confirmed on staging with the build noted below.

session token of tajog-fahaf = htk21_4ae55819f45410afcb307

### Step 4: Re-point the spooler

Stop the legacy Quillpress spooler before starting Fennich. Do not run both; they contend for the same print queue lock. Copy your queue directory across, then clear stale lock files. Fennich ignores the old INI format entirely. Before first start, confirm the service picks up the configuration values shown below.

service settings:
PRAIX_LOG_LEVEL=error
PRAIX_METRICS_HOST=metrics.praix.qorvelcorp.corp
PRAIX_POOL_SIZE=16